什么是DNS解析错误?如何快速解决服务器DNS解析错误?

   360SEO    

如果服务器的DNS解析失败,这可能会影响网站或服务的可用性和性能。在这种情况下,需要采取一些措施来解决问题。以下是一些可能的解决方案:

1、检查网络连接

首先需要确保服务器已连接到互联网,并且网络连接正常。如果其他设备或浏览器可以访问该网站或服务,则可以排除客户端问题。如果问题仍然存在,则可能需要检查网络连接并解决任何相关问题。

2、检查DNS设置

如果网络连接正常,则可能需要检查服务器的DNS设置,以确保其正确配置。可以查看服务器的网络配置文件,如/etc/resolv.conf文件,确认DNS服务器地址是否正确,尝试更改为其他公共DNS服务器,如Google DNS(8.8.8.8和8.8.4.4)或Cloudflare DNS(1.1.1.1和1.0.0.1)。

3、清除DNS缓存

在服务器上运行以下命令来清除DNS缓存:

systemd-resolve --flush-caches

如果使用的是Windows操作系统,可以打开命令提示符并运行以下命令:

ipconfig /flushdns

这可以帮助消除任何DNS缓存问题,以确保DNS解析不受任何旧缓存数据的影响。

4、重启网络服务

如果以上步骤未能解决问题,则可以尝试重启服务器的网络服务,以重新加载配置并解决任何临时问题。具体方法取决于服务器操作系统:

Linux系统:使用以下命令重启网络服务:

sudo service networking restartsudo systemctl restart networking

Windows系统:打开“服务”管理工具,找到并重新启动网络服务。

5、检查防火墙设置

如果服务器上安装了防火墙,则需要检查防火墙设置,确保没有阻止DNS解析请求,如果有防火墙,请确保允许UDP端口53(DNS)通过,以确保流量可以正常通过。

6、联系网络管理员

如果以上步骤都无法解决问题,则建议联系网络管理员,寻求更详细的诊断和解决方案。他们可能需要进行更深入的研究,以了解服务器和网络环境的复杂问题。

7、使用备用域名服务器

如果可能的话,则可以尝试使用备用的域名服务器进行DNS解析,可以通过修改服务器的DNS配置文件来实现,将首选DNS服务器设置为备用DNS服务器的IP地址。这可以帮助解决一些因特殊地理位置或其他时钟问题引起的DNS解析失败问题。

总之,在服务器出现DNS解析问题时,需要先确认网络连接是否正常,然后检查DNS服务器设置,清除DNS缓存,重启网络服务,并检查防火墙设置和其他有关的配置。如果所有的解决方案都不能解决问题,建议联系网络管理员以获得更多支持。

我们希望这些解决方案可以帮助您解决服务器DNS解析问题,确保您的网站或服务始终能够保持高效和稳定运行。

如果您对此文章有任何疑问或意见,请随时在下方留言,我们非常乐意听取您的反馈和建议。谢谢您的阅读,期待您的评论、关注、点赞和感谢!

 标签:

评论留言

我要留言

欢迎参与讨论,请在这里发表您的看法、交流您的观点。